Why training governance matters more than training volume
Many firms invest in large amounts of ERP training content yet still experience inconsistent delivery. The root issue is governance, not content quantity. Governance defines who must learn what, when they must demonstrate proficiency, how exceptions are handled, and how delivery standards are enforced across practices, geographies, and client engagements. Without this structure, consultants may know isolated features in Project, Planning, Timesheets, Accounting, Documents, or Knowledge, but still fail to execute a coherent implementation approach.
In professional services, the ERP is not only a back-office platform. It is a delivery system for project planning, resource utilization, billing, revenue recognition support, document control, service workflows, and management reporting. That makes consultant adoption a strategic capability. If one team configures project stages differently from another, or if timesheet governance is interpreted inconsistently across subsidiaries, leadership loses comparability, margin visibility, and operational control. Training governance is therefore a business architecture issue as much as a learning issue.
Start with discovery: what the organization is really trying to standardize
The first implementation step is discovery and assessment. Before defining a training curriculum, leadership should identify which business outcomes require standard behavior. In professional services, these usually include opportunity-to-project handoff, project setup, resource planning, time capture, expense control, milestone billing, change requests, document approvals, and management reporting. Discovery should also assess the current maturity of delivery methods, the degree of process variation between business units, and the level of ERP fluency among consultants and managers.
This phase should produce a training governance baseline tied to business process analysis. Rather than asking only which screens users need to learn, the program should ask which decisions must be made consistently. For example, who can create project templates, who approves rate cards, how cross-company staffing is handled, and how project profitability is reviewed. These decisions shape the functional design and determine where governance controls belong in the ERP and in the operating model.
| Assessment area | Key business question | Governance implication |
|---|---|---|
| Process maturity | Which delivery processes are standardized today? | Defines where training can reinforce standards versus where redesign is required |
| Role clarity | Do consultants, PMs, finance, and leadership share the same responsibilities? | Determines role-based learning paths and approval controls |
| System landscape | Which tools currently manage projects, time, billing, and reporting? | Shapes integration strategy and transition planning |
| Data quality | Are customer, employee, project, and service data governed centrally? | Influences migration readiness and master data governance |
| Change readiness | How willing are teams to adopt common methods? | Guides organizational change management and executive sponsorship |
Design the operating model before designing the curriculum
A common mistake is to build training around application menus instead of the target operating model. In a well-governed Odoo program, the operating model comes first. This includes executive governance, project governance, process ownership, approval rights, escalation paths, and service delivery standards. Only then should the organization define the training strategy. The curriculum should map directly to the future-state operating model and the approved solution architecture.
For professional services firms, Odoo applications such as CRM, Sales, Project, Planning, Accounting, Documents, Knowledge, Helpdesk, and Spreadsheet are often relevant because they support the full client delivery lifecycle. However, application selection should follow business need. If the firm requires structured knowledge transfer and reusable implementation assets, Knowledge and Documents may be justified. If resource scheduling is central to margin control, Planning becomes important. If support transitions after go-live are part of the service model, Helpdesk may be appropriate. Training governance should explain not only how these applications work, but why each one exists in the delivery model.
Functional and technical design decisions that affect adoption
Consultant adoption improves when functional design and technical design reduce ambiguity. Functional design should define standard project templates, task structures, timesheet policies, billing triggers, approval workflows, and reporting dimensions. Technical design should define identity and access management, role-based permissions, auditability, integration patterns, and environment controls. When these are left open to interpretation, training becomes inconsistent because each team teaches a different version of the process.
Configuration strategy should prioritize standard Odoo capabilities where they support the target process with acceptable control and usability. Customization strategy should be reserved for differentiating requirements, regulatory needs, or material workflow gaps. OCA module evaluation can be appropriate where mature community modules address a real business requirement with manageable support implications, but each module should be reviewed for maintainability, upgrade impact, security posture, and fit with the enterprise architecture. Training governance should explicitly distinguish standard behavior, approved extensions, and prohibited workarounds.
Build role-based enablement around delivery accountability
The most effective ERP training programs are role-based and outcome-based. A consultant does not need the same depth as a finance controller, and a project manager needs different controls than a solution architect. Governance should define mandatory competencies by role, including process understanding, system execution, exception handling, data stewardship, and reporting interpretation. This is especially important in multi-company implementations where local practices may differ but group-level governance must remain intact.
- Executives should be trained on governance dashboards, approval models, risk indicators, and decision rights rather than transaction entry.
- Project managers should be trained on project setup standards, planning discipline, change control, utilization reporting, and issue escalation.
- Consultants should be trained on delivery workflows, time and expense compliance, document management, knowledge capture, and client handoff procedures.
- Finance and operations teams should be trained on billing controls, revenue support processes, master data stewardship, and reconciliation points.
- Administrators and architects should be trained on security, environment management, integrations, release controls, and support operating procedures.

Integration, data, and cloud decisions must be included in training governance
Training governance often fails because it ignores the broader enterprise environment. In professional services, Odoo may need to integrate with HR systems, payroll, identity providers, document repositories, BI platforms, customer support tools, or legacy finance applications during transition periods. An API-first architecture is essential because consultants need to understand where the system of record sits, which data is synchronized, and what happens when integrations fail. Training should therefore include integration operating procedures, not just application usage.
Data migration strategy and master data governance are equally important. If project templates, customer records, employee profiles, service catalogs, analytic dimensions, and rate structures are migrated without ownership rules, adoption deteriorates quickly. Users lose trust in the system and revert to spreadsheets or local workarounds. Governance should define data owners, approval workflows, naming conventions, archival rules, and post-migration validation responsibilities. In multi-company environments, this becomes critical for shared customers, intercompany staffing, and consolidated reporting.
Cloud deployment strategy also affects training and delivery consistency. Teams need clarity on environment purpose, release cadence, backup and recovery expectations, business continuity procedures, and support boundaries. Where directly relevant, enterprise operations may include containerized deployment patterns using Docker and Kubernetes, with PostgreSQL, Redis, monitoring, and observability controls supporting resilience and enterprise scalability. These topics are not end-user training subjects, but they are essential for administrators, architects, and managed service teams responsible for stable delivery.
Testing is where governance becomes measurable
A training program is only credible if it improves execution quality. That is why User Acceptance Testing, performance testing, and security testing should be integrated into the governance model. UAT should validate not only whether the system works, but whether trained users can execute the target process consistently. Test scenarios should cover project creation, staffing, timesheet submission, billing events, approval workflows, reporting, and exception handling. Results should be reviewed by process owners, not only by the implementation team.
Performance testing matters when large consulting teams, high transaction volumes, or integrated reporting cycles create operational pressure. Security testing matters because professional services firms handle sensitive client, employee, and financial data. Identity and access management should be validated against segregation of duties, approval rights, and least-privilege principles. Training governance should require that users understand the controls relevant to their role, especially where client confidentiality and compliance obligations are involved.
| Governance checkpoint | What to validate | Leadership signal |
|---|---|---|
| UAT readiness | Users can complete end-to-end scenarios without undocumented workarounds | Training is producing operational competence |
| Performance readiness | Critical workflows remain responsive under expected load | The platform can support delivery at scale |
| Security readiness | Access rights, approvals, and audit trails match policy | Governance controls are enforceable |
| Data readiness | Master data is accurate, owned, and usable for reporting | Decision-making can rely on the ERP |
| Support readiness | Hypercare teams know triage, escalation, and resolution procedures | Go-live risk is contained |
Go-live, hypercare, and continuous improvement should reinforce the learning system
Go-live planning should treat training governance as a control gate, not a communications milestone. Before cutover, leadership should confirm role readiness, support coverage, issue triage procedures, fallback plans, and business continuity measures. Hypercare should then capture where users struggle, which process steps generate exceptions, and where additional coaching or design refinement is needed. This creates a feedback loop between adoption and solution quality.
Continuous improvement should be governed through a formal backlog that separates defects, training gaps, process changes, and enhancement requests. This prevents every adoption issue from becoming a customization request. Workflow automation opportunities can then be prioritized based on business value, control improvement, and user effort reduction. AI-assisted implementation opportunities are also emerging here, particularly for knowledge retrieval, test case generation, document summarization, support triage, and analytics interpretation. These should be introduced carefully, with governance over data access, model usage, and human review.
Executive recommendations for a scalable training governance model
Leadership teams should approach ERP training governance as a portfolio capability rather than a project task. The strongest model combines executive sponsorship, process ownership, architecture discipline, and measurable adoption controls. It also recognizes that delivery consistency is a competitive asset for professional services firms because it improves client confidence, margin protection, and scalability across practices.
- Establish a governance board that includes business leaders, process owners, architecture, security, and delivery leadership.
- Define role-based certification criteria tied to real process execution, not course completion alone.
- Standardize project templates, approval models, reporting dimensions, and master data rules before broad rollout.
- Use configuration-first design and tightly govern customizations and OCA module adoption.
- Embed UAT, security, and support readiness into training sign-off criteria.
- Treat hypercare findings as input to both process optimization and curriculum refinement.
